Long Bien Bridge
Architecturally and historically important, this bridge aided Vietnam’s independence efforts. It symbolizes the country's military resistance and engineering skills.

St. Joseph's Cathedral of Hanoi
At the heart of Hanoi stands a weathered neo-Gothic Roman Catholic church, a contrary sight in this predominantly Buddhist city.

Hanoi Opera House
This historic building is the centrepiece of Hanoi’s French Quarter and host to shows by many of Vietnam’s premier singers, dancers and musicians.
